Bye Bye Brady. Twitter was on fire again today as we were treated to two more crazy Wild Card games. In the first, the Baltimore Ravens put an end to the once-mighty New England Patriots season 33-14. Yeah that was cool, but nothing could prepare us for the nightcap which was the highest-scoring post season game in history. In the end, QB Aaron Rodgers fumbled the game away in OT. The final score: Arizona Cardinals 51 Green Bay Packers 45. […]

The rumor is true. The 1515 Boys have confirmed that Banks and his accomplices are currently detained in Canada for allegedly assaulting and robbing a local promoter two nights ago. Sergeant Brad Finucan of the Waterloo Regional Police’s Criminal Investigations branch told MTV News on Sunday (January 10) that Banks (real name: Christopher Lloyd) and three associates got into a dispute with the promoter at a local hotel over payment for performance and an appearance fee.
